1. A method for hybrid automatic repeat request (HARQ) reporting of a user equipment (UE), comprising:
determining, by the UE, a hybrid automatic repeat request (HARQ) information in response to one or more transport blocks (TBs) in a received physical sidelink shared channel (PSSCH) in a resource pool; and
selecting a sequence cyclic shift for the HARQ information in a physical sidelink feedback channel (PSFCH) transmission in the resource pool, wherein the sequence cyclic shift is generated according to a pre-configured or network configured initial cyclic shifting value;
wherein the method further comprises:
decoding, by the UE, an associated sidelink control information (SCI) scheduling the received PSSCH, wherein the SCI comprises a HARQ feedback indicator for enabling or disabling a HARQ feedback reporting of the HARQ information from the UE, wherein the HARQ information is given in a positive acknowledgement (ACK)/negative acknowledgement (NACK) representation format comprising a full format of ACK or NACK, or a reduced format of ACK-only or NACK-only;
determining, by the UE, whether to perform the HARQ feedback reporting for the received PSSCH is based on the HARQ feedback indicator in the associated SCI;
wherein the HARQ feedback reporting for the received PSSCH is based on an ACK/NACK representation format;
wherein a selection or determination of the ACK/NACK representation format is based on a group size of a groupcast that serves as a sidelink cast type;
for the groupcast, either the full format or the reduced format is used, a selection of which format to use is based on the group size of the groupcast and/or an indication in the associated SCI;
when the group size of the groupcast is known, the UE selects the full format of ACK or NACK; and
when the group size of the groupcast is larger than a pre-define/fixed value or number of candidate PSFCH resources, the UE follows an ACK/NACK representation format indicated in the associated SCI or selects the reduced format of ACK-only or NACK-only.
